Birthdate: October 10, 1837
Sun Sign: Libra
Birthplace: Boston, Massachusetts, U.S.
Died: July 18, 1863
Robert Gould Shaw served as a Union Army officer during the Civil War and led the first all-black regiment in the Northeast, the 54th Massachusetts. He fought for equal treatment and pay for his troops and led them in the Second Battle of Fort Wagner, where he displayed exceptional leadership before losing his life. Shaw’s leadership and the bravery of his regiment inspired many African Americans to enlist, making a significant contribution to the Union’s victory in the war.
